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Assessment

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common warning signs that show you need a Water Damage Assessment: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Don’t ignore these smells, they can be a sign of a more serious issue.

Water Stains or Warping

Visible water stains or warping wood can show water damage that’s not yet visible.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call us today to schedule an assessment.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or hidden moisture.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s down the line.

Increased Humidity

High humidity levels can show h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call us today to schedule an assessment.

Unexplained Mold Growth

Unexplained mold growth can show hidden moisture and potential health risks. Don’t ignore these signs, call us today to schedule an assessment.

Water Damage Assessment v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a single room Yes No DIY repairs are usually enough for small leaks.
Water damage in multiple rooms or floors No Yes Complex water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ise.
Hidden moisture or mold growth No Yes Hidden moisture and mold growth need professional detection and remediation.
Water damage caused by a burst pipe No Yes Burst pipes need immediate attention and professional repair.
Water damage in a commercial building No Yes Commercial water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ure safe and efficient restoration.
Water damage caused by a natural disaster No Yes Natural disasters need professional assessment and restoration to ensure safety and reduce damage.

While DIY repairs may seem like a cost-effective solution, they can often lead to more extensive and costly problems down the line. If you’re unsure about the extent of the damage or the best course of action, it’s always best to call a professional.
